Following his Oscar success with The Social Network, Trent Reznor of Nine Inch Nails is at it again, this time he’s scored the soundtrack to The Girl With The Dragon Tattoo. Reznor is reprising his partnership with Atticus Ross, who co-scored The Social Network with him. The soundtrack is out now for download and is also available as a 3-CD package or a 6-vinyl deluxe limited edition.
David Fincher directed the film adaption of the Steig Larson novel. Fincher is known for such movies as: The Social Network, Se7en, Fight Club and The Curious Case of Benjamin Button. If that’s not enough of a resume jaw dropper, he’s also directed videos for: Madonna, Sting, The Rolling Stones, Michael Jackson, Aerosmith, George Michael, Iggy Pop, The Wallflowers, Billy Idol, Steve Winwood, The Motels, and A Perfect Circle.
The Girl with The Dragon Tattoo stars Daniel Craig and Christopher Plummer, and is out on December 21st. Check out the trailer which which features a powerful version of Led Zeppelin’s “The Immigrant Song” from Karen O of the Yeah Yeah Yeahs.
